Collie is a general name for certain breeds of herding dog originating primarily in Scotland. The exact origin of the name is uncertain, although it probably originates in Older Scots col(l) (coal), meaning black. The popularity of the Lassie movies and television shows, which starred Rough Collies, has commonly associated Collie specifically with this breed. However, there are several breeds of collie: The Scotch collie (or Scottish collie) is a common reference in the 19th and early 20th centuries, but it refers to the original Scottish breed of dog. Scotch collies were heavier and less fine-boned than today's Rough and Smooth dogs.
